Hiroki Tsuzuki of Shishin referred to prosecutors for alleged nuisance ordinance violation
Hiroki Tsuzuki, a member of the popular comedy trio Shishin, has been referred to prosecutors for allegedly violating the Tokyo Metropolitan Ordinance on Prevention of Nuisance. The incident reportedly occurred in late June 2026 at an event venue in Tokyo, where Tsuzuki is accused of touching a woman in her 20s over her clothing. Tsuzuki has reportedly admitted to the allegations, stating that he was under the influence of alcohol at the time.
Watanabe Entertainment, the talent agency representing Tsuzuki, issued a statement apologizing to the victim and announcing that Tsuzuki will be suspended from all activities for the time being. Consequently, the remaining two members of Shishin, Takumi Goto and Ryota Ishibashi, will continue the group's activities. The incident has had immediate professional repercussions, including the suspension of Tsuzuki's fashion brand, HIROKI TSUZUKI, and the temporary removal of certain related content from streaming services.
Public reaction has been largely critical, particularly regarding Tsuzuki's use of alcohol as an explanation for his behavior. While some figures, such as rakugo performer Sharaku Tachikawa, expressed disappointment in the incident, they also offered words of support for his potential recovery. The scandal has also impacted the group's radio appearances and broader media presence.
